Home
last modified time | relevance | path

Searched refs:BaseFieldItem (Results 1 - 12 of 12) sorted by relevance

/arkcompiler/runtime_core/static_core/assembler/
H A Dassembly-emitter.h47 std::unordered_map<std::string, panda_file::BaseFieldItem *> fieldItems;
215 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ields);
220 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
227 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
234 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
241 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
246 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
254 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
H A Dassembly-emitter.cpp33 using ark::panda_file::BaseFieldItem;
461 const std::unordered_map<std::string, BaseFieldItem *> &fields) in CreateScalarEnumValueItem()
483 const std::unordered_map<std::string, BaseFieldItem *> &fields, in CreateScalarAnnotationValueItem()
505 const std::unordered_map<std::string, BaseFieldItem *> &fields, in CreateScalarValueItem()
557 const std::unordered_map<std::string, BaseFieldItem *> &fields, in CreateValueItem()
584 const std::unordered_map<std::string, BaseFieldItem *> &fields, in CreateAnnotationItem()
646 const std::unordered_map<std::string, BaseFieldItem *> &fields, in CreateMethodHandleItem()
678 const std::unordered_map<std::string, BaseFieldItem *> &fields, in AddAnnotations()
978 BaseFieldItem *field; in HandleFields()
1643 const std::unordered_map<std::string, panda_file::BaseFieldItem *> in Emit()
[all...]
H A Dassembly-function.h137 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
H A Dassembly-ins.h126 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
/arkcompiler/runtime_core/assembler/
H A Dassembly-emitter.h46 std::unordered_map<std::string, panda_file::BaseFieldItem *> field_items;
208 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ields);
227 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
H A Dassembly-function.h157 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
H A Dassembly-ins.h112 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ields,
H A Dassembly-emitter.cpp36 using panda::panda_file::BaseFieldItem;
298 const std::unordered_map<std::string, BaseFieldItem *> &fields) in CreateScalarEnumValueItem()
464 const std::unordered_map<std::string, BaseFieldItem *> &fields, in CreateMethodHandleItem()
835 BaseFieldItem *field; in HandleFields()
1594 const std::unordered_map<std::string, panda_file::BaseFieldItem *> &fields, in Emit()
/arkcompiler/runtime_core/libpandafile/
H A Dfile_items.cpp1251 BaseFieldItem::BaseFieldItem(BaseClassItem *cls, StringItem *name, TypeItem *type, ItemContainer *container) in BaseFieldItem() function in panda::panda_file::BaseFieldItem
1258 size_t BaseFieldItem::CalculateSize() const in CalculateSize()
1264 bool BaseFieldItem::Write(Writer *writer) in Write()
1282 : BaseFieldItem(cls, name, type, container), access_flags_(access_flags), value_(nullptr) in FieldItem()
1294 size_t size = BaseFieldItem::CalculateSize() + leb128::UnsignedEncodingSize(access_flags_); in CalculateSize()
1390 if (!BaseFieldItem::Write(writer)) { in Write()
H A Dfile_items.h502 class BaseFieldItem : public IndexedItem { class in panda::panda_file::ClassTag::MethodTag::FieldTag::FunctionKind::ItemRank
514 ~BaseFieldItem() override = default;
516 DEFAULT_MOVE_SEMANTIC(BaseFieldItem);
517 DEFAULT_COPY_SEMANTIC(BaseFieldItem);
520 BaseFieldItem(BaseClassItem *cls, StringItem *name, TypeItem *type, ItemContainer *container);
532 class FieldItem : public BaseFieldItem {
1225 class ForeignFieldItem : public BaseFieldItem {
1228 : BaseFieldItem(cls, name, type, container) {} in ForeignFieldItem()
/arkcompiler/runtime_core/static_core/libpandafile/
H A Dfile_items.cpp1187 BaseFieldItem::BaseFieldItem(BaseClassItem *cls, StringItem *name, TypeItem *type) in BaseFieldItem() function in ark::panda_file::BaseFieldItem
1194 size_t BaseFieldItem::CalculateSize() const in CalculateSize()
1200 bool BaseFieldItem::Write(Writer *writer) in Write()
1218 : BaseFieldItem(cls, name, type), accessFlags_(accessFlags) in FieldItem()
1230 size_t size = BaseFieldItem::CalculateSize() + leb128::UnsignedEncodingSize(accessFlags_); in CalculateSize()
1326 if (!BaseFieldItem::Write(writer)) { in Write()
H A Dfile_items.h470 class BaseFieldItem : public IndexedItem { class in ark::panda_file::ClassTag::MethodTag::FieldTag
492 ~BaseFieldItem() override = default;
494 DEFAULT_MOVE_SEMANTIC(BaseFieldItem);
495 DEFAULT_COPY_SEMANTIC(BaseFieldItem);
498 BaseFieldItem(BaseClassItem *cls, StringItem *name, TypeItem *type);
510 class FieldItem : public BaseFieldItem {
1301 class ForeignFieldItem : public BaseFieldItem {
1303 ForeignFieldItem(BaseClassItem *cls, StringItem *name, TypeItem *type) : BaseFieldItem(cls, name, type) {} in ForeignFieldItem()

Completed in 21 milliseconds